Find the area of a circle whose radius is 12 m long.

The area S of any circle is calculated by the formula S = π * r², where r is the radius of this circle, π is the number pi.
According to the condition of the problem, the length of the radius of this circle is 12 m, therefore the area of this circle is:
π * 12² = π * 144 m².
Answer: the area of this circle is π * 144 m².
